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Riding Mill to Bredbury start from as little as £24.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Riding Mill to Bredbury are available for £94.70 one way, or £150.40 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

The station is equipped with basic yet vital facilities. Ticket purchasing is streamlined thanks to the presence of ticket machines that allow you to collect your tickets with ease. Unfortunately, there is no staffed ticket office or accessible ticket machines, but an induction loop is available. CCTV ensures safety around the station.

Regarding accessibility, Riding Mill falls under Category B, which indicates partial step-free access. There is a level access to the Carlisle platform, while reaching the Newcastle platform involves either a footbridge or a 700-meter partially unlit road. Boarding ramps are available and assistance can be arranged via the Passenger Assist program.

Facilities at Bredbury Station

Bredbury Station combines simplicity with essential amenities. Open for ticket purchasing from 06:20 to 20:40 on weekdays and with slightly reduced hours on Saturdays, it is convenient for early-bird commuters and evening travelers alike. While there's no service on Sundays, ticket machines are available for easy access to ticket collection or purchasing, but unfortunately, you won't find accessible ticket machines here.

For those requiring auditory assistance, an induction loop is available. However, for those who might seek mobility support, access is thoroughly described but not entirely step-free, classified as a Category C station. Notably, while facilities for storing bicycles do exist, there's no availability for bicycle hire directly from the station premises.
